编程用奇数怎么表示

时间:2025-02-28 02:17:32 明星趣事

在编程中,可以通过以下几种方式来表示奇数:

使用取余运算符(%)

通过对一个数除以2取余,如果结果为1,则表示该数为奇数。例如,如果一个数 `n` % 2 的结果为1,那么 `n` 就是一个奇数。

使用位运算符(&)

可以使用位运算中的“与”操作符(&)来判断一个数的最后一位是否为1。如果最后一位为1,则表示该数为奇数。例如,对于一个数 `n`,如果 `n` & 1 的结果为1,那么 `n` 就是一个奇数。

使用条件语句(if-else)

可以使用条件语句来判断一个数是否为奇数。例如,如果一个数 `n` 不能被2整除,那么它就是奇数。可以使用取余运算符(%)来判断一个数是否能被2整除。

使用数学公式

奇数可以用数学公式来表示,例如,`2n+1` 就是一个奇数,其中 `n` 是任意整数。这种方法特别适用于生成一系列连续的奇数。

使用奇数函数

可以定义一个奇数函数,其输出结果仅为奇数。例如,在Python中可以使用以下代码定义一个简单的奇数函数:

```python

def is_odd(number):

return number % 2 != 0

```

这些方法可以根据具体编程语言和需求选择使用。例如,在C语言中,可以使用取余运算符或位运算符来判断奇数;在Python中,可以使用取余运算符、位运算符或定义奇数函数。